Elen Stokes is a scholar working on Law,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law and Strategy and Management. According to data from OpenAlex, Elen Stokes has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 218 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Law, 6 papers in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law and 5 papers in Strategy and Management. Recurrent topics in Elen Stokes's work include Environmental law and policy (5 papers), International Environmental Law and Policies (4 papers) and Wildlife Conservation and Criminology Analyses (2 papers). Elen Stokes is often cited by papers focused on Environmental law and policy (5 papers), International Environmental Law and Policies (4 papers) and Wildlife Conservation and Criminology Analyses (2 papers). Elen Stokes coll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Netherlands. Elen Stokes's co-authors include Robert Lee, Diana M. Bowman, Christopher Groves, Robert Lee, Arie Rip, Robert Lee, Stijn Smismans, Stuart Bell, Donald McGillivray and Emma Lees and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Business Ethics, Journal of Risk Research and Journal of Law and Society.
